Subject: Cut-over complete — Marlowe search relevance

Cut-over to the new relevance profile finished at 22:40. Synonym expansion is now on by default; phrase boosts were retuned per last week's notes. If click-through drops overnight, roll back via the standard toggle — no redeploy needed. Watch the zero-results rate especially. The live tuning parameters after the cut-over are as follows.

settings of yaguf-bahip:
druwyn:
  log_level: debug
  metrics_host: metrics.druwyn.qorvelsys.internal
  pool_size: 32

## Changelog — Tidemark Widget 3.2

Defaults changed. Read before touching anything.

- Refresh interval now hourly, not every 15 min. Harbor feeds from the Pellisport aggregator throttle aggressive polling.
- Lunar-offset correction is on by default. Disable only for legacy Kestrel Bay deployments.
- Chart units default to metric. The imperial fallback flag is deprecated and will be removed in 3.4.
- Cache eviction is now time-based, not size-based.

New installs should start from the default configuration values listed below.

config for kahap-taweg:
oliox:
  pin: 8609
  tenant: casath
  seal: seal_632a4a6f
  metrics_host: metrics.oliox.nelvrogrid.example
  standby_team: keleth
  escalation: briiel-oliwyn
  nonce: e2397c

## Environments

MergeMinder, our customer-record deduplication service, runs in three environments: dev, staging, and prod. Dev points at a scrubbed snapshot refreshed weekly; staging mirrors prod topology but with matching thresholds loosened for testing. Prod runs the strict matcher and writes merge decisions to the audit ledger. Promotion always goes dev → staging → prod, never skipping. Each environment boots with the following configuration values.

service settings:
PRAIX_LOG_LEVEL=error
PRAIX_METRICS_HOST=metrics.praix.qorvelcorp.corp
PRAIX_POOL_SIZE=16